I use my macbook pro in a lab that I work in at a university. When I plug in the ethernet cable (connecting my comp to the network), I notice that my cpu usage jumps from near 0% to 50 - 75%. I found that the nmbd program is using nearly 100% of one of the two cores in my CPU!!! I have read that this is part of the samba package designed for windows file sharing. I have turned OFF all sharing on my mac, yet the nmbd problem persists. I am at a loss for what to do now. Please help!
